Job Details Job DetailsLevel: ExperiencedPosition Type: Full TimeSalary Range: $90,000.00 - $110,000.00 Salary/yearTravel Percentage: Road WarriorJob Shift: Day General Job Description Parkway Construction is seeking an experienced Traveling Superintendent with a proven track record in commercial ground-up projects. National travel is an essential aspect of this role. As a leading General Contractor operating across all lower 48 states, Parkway offers an opportunity to join a rapidly growing commercial construction company known for its excellence in building partnerships with our customers, delivering excellent projects, and developing excellent people. Superintendents are responsible for directing on-site project workflow to ensure alignment with the project schedule and Parkway’s safety and quality standards. In collaboration with the project management team, the Superintendent aligns project objectives with the goals of both Parkway and its customers, striving for operational excellence. This role also involves overseeing subcontractors, effectively communicating project priorities, and serving as the primary on-site leader. Duties & Responsibilities Must be able to travel away from home for extended periods of time. Oversee total construction effort to ensure project is constructed in accordance with design, budget, and schedule. Includes interfacing with client representatives, subcontractors, security, etc. Maintain liaison with project teams to ensure work complies with drawings, specifications, and schedule. Create project plans and secures commitments from trade partners for on-site work. Ensures the team is accountable for their commitments and adherence to the overall project schedule. Superintendent must be on site if trade partners are performing work. Assist in resolving construction problems (lack of productivity, work interfaces, etc.) as required. Assist Labor Relations Department in maintaining communications with unions, resolving jurisdictional disputes, requisitioning required manpower, etc., as necessary. Assist project management in developing and implementing project procedures, working documents, standards, etc. Provide clear and concise verbal and written communication with owner representatives, trade partners, AHJ (Authority Having Jurisdiction) representatives, vendors, and others as needed. Ensure all onsite personnel comply with project procedures, safety program requirements, work rules, etc. Document all violations, notify project management, and recommend/implement corrective actions as required. Assume responsibility for productivity of trades, efficient use of materials & equipment, and contractual performance of the project. Maintain communication with material control, purchasing, quality control, and engineering departments to ensure timely provision of materials, equipment, and inspections supporting trades' activities and the overall project schedule.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of project activities, including daily logs, progress reports, and documentation in Procore for any changes or deviations on the project. Implement and enforce safety protocols to ensure a safe working environment for all on-site personnel. Assume additional responsibilities and assignments per supervisor's direction. Qualifications Education & Training Educational and experience requirements include: 5 or more years of technical training and/or experience. Cal OSHA 10 or OSHA 30 Certification (preferred) Knowledge & Experience Minimum 5 years of experience in commercial construction, preferably with a traveling commercial general contractor. Experience with ground up construction of Healthcare, Hospitality, Restaurant, and/or Retail projects is preferred. Proficient with software systems including but not limited to: Procore and Microsoft Office suite (ex. Projects, Excel, Word, Outlook, PowerPoint, etc.). Basic understanding of Lean Building principles is a plus. Skills & Abilities Responsible for on-site management of project, with home office support. Able to Communicate (both oral & written) with co-workers, management, subcontractors, and others in a courteous and professional manner. Ability to control and supervise large groups is essential. Ability to collaborate with all trade partners to achieve project milestones and maintain schedule. Advanced understanding of construction scheduling and cost control. Ability to organize and manage tasks and priorities to meet critical deadlines. Understand local jurisdictional (AHJ) requirements, build relationships with AHJ and inspectors, and ensure all applicable AHJ and 3rd-party inspections are completed timely. Ability to be a "road warrior" and travel away from home for extended periods of time. Physical Abilities Standing for Extended Periods: Ability to stand for long periods, particularly when supervising ongoing operations or conducting site inspections. Walking: Capability to walk long distances across job sites, including uneven terrain, to effectively monitor and oversee various aspects of the work environment. Crawling: Capability to crawl under structures, as necessary, for inspection, troubleshooting, or other work-related tasks. Climbing: Ability to climb ladders, scaffolding, or other structures to access elevated areas, ensuring that all aspects of the job site are monitored and managed effectively.
